Our aim is to reveal the quality potential of the traditional orchards that we foster in Devon, while cultivating, nurturing and encouraging them to thrive.
We work with farmers to help breathe life back into traditional orchards on their farms; to prevent further decline and the extinction of important local apple varieties.
In most cases the apples in these orchards were previously left to rot on the ground year after year, yet they include incredible cider varieties as well as unusual local dessert and cooking varieties. Many of these varieties are rare or on the verge of extinction but make beautiful cider.
The cidery itself is located in an old stable yard in the village of Huxham near Exeter. With capacity for 9000 bottles per year, this is a small but focussed operation. There aren’t any bells and whistles in sight, just outstanding cider and two people, whole heartedly devoted to their produce.

250ml can from Caps and Taps. Orangey gold colour, white foam head that quickly dissipates to a thin rim and aroma of juicy ripe apple, fruity, funk. Taste is tangy, slightly tart, apple, fruity, juicy, alittle core, with farmhouse funk and some tannins. Medium bodied, light carbonation, dry tangy & tannic finish. Nicely drinkable.

Bottle pour at The Cider House - Borough Market, pours a hazy golden, no head. Aroma brings out crisp apple skins, champagne-like effervescence, and gentle farmhouse notes. Flavour is bone dry, with horse blanket, subtle champagne-like effervescence, and musty dry apple skins. I like the dryness, but I wish there was more funk, more complexity, and some carbonation. Good but could be improved a bit in a number of dimensions.
